Tracking Your Taxes: Park Pork?
February 9, 2010 - 12:05 PM | by: William La Jeunesse
If
you are hoping to visit the newest crown jewel in America's park system
chosen by Congress, throw away the car keys and open up your wallet.
The 2,900 pristine acres of beachfront property were not cheap -- or
even in the United States.
The property soliciting accusations of
"pork" from critics is the Castle Nugent National Historic Park. It's
in the U.S. Virgin Islands, about a thousand miles from Miami and an
expensive jet ride to get there.
Two weeks ago, on a near party line vote, a
huge Democratic majority in the House agreed to spend $50 million to
buy the former cotton plantation on the island of St. Croix.
